WebVector Subtraction Examples Example 1: Compute the vector subtraction a - b if a = <1, -2, 5> and b = <3, -1, 2>. Also, find its magnitude. Solution: Given that a = <1, -2, 5> and b = <3, -1, 2>. Now we will find their difference by subtracting the respective components. a - b = <1, -2, 5> - <3, -1, 2> = <1 - 3, -2 - (-1), 5 - 2> = <-2, -1, 3>
